Key Information: ICD-10 Coding for GERD Unspecified (K21.9)

Essential facts and insights about ICD-10 Coding for GERD Unspecified (K21.9)

Use ICD-10 code K21.9 for gastro-esophageal reflux disease without esophagitis, ensuring proper documentation in clinical notes.

Primary ICD-10-CM Codes

Gastro-esophageal reflux disease without esophagitis

Billable Code
K21.9
Billable

Diagnostic Criteria

clinical:
  • • Endoscopy shows no esophagitis
documentation:
  • • Provider notes absence of esophagitis

Applicable To

  • • GERD without esophagitis
  • • Acid reflux without esophagitis

Important Notes

  • • Ensure documentation explicitly states absence of esophagitis.
Ancillary Codes

Additional codes that may be used with this diagnosis

K22.70

Barrett’s esophagus without dysplasia

Use when Barrett’s esophagus is present without dysplasia.

J98.01

Acute bronchospasm

Use if GERD exacerbates respiratory symptoms.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the ICD-10 code for GERD unspecified?

The ICD-10 code for GERD unspecified is K21.9, used when GERD is diagnosed without evidence of esophagitis or bleeding.

When should K21.9 be used?

Use K21.9 when GERD is diagnosed without esophagitis or bleeding, confirmed by endoscopy and pH monitoring.
